Just wondering, gonna start engine conversion, vq304 EFI donor, into VH 6cyl, better to lift motor gearbox out or lift body up, I suppose the angle of the lift of motor gearbox vs body and rolling out !! Any advice and all advice thanks peeps

Either way...Lift motor and gearbox as a unit, or motor seperate to gearbox...You could even drop the front cross member and lift the body over the motor....however, lifting the motor and gearbox as a unit is much easier and safer in my opinion, because you don't have a massive shell to move out of the way
